Single ply roof replacement involves removing an existing roof made of single ply membrane materials and installing a new, durable roofing system. This process typically includes inspecting the current roof, preparing the surface, and carefully installing the new membrane to ensure a seamless, watertight barrier. Many service providers use high-quality materials like TPO, PVC, or EPDM to provide long-lasting protection against weather elements. Homeowners considering this service should look for experienced contractors who can assess their roof’s condition and recommend the best replacement options for their property.
This type of roof replacement is especially effective in solving common roofing problems such as leaks, extensive membrane damage, or aging materials that no longer provide adequate protection. Over time, single ply membranes can develop tears, cracks, or become brittle, leading to water infiltration and potential structural issues. Replacing the roof with a new membrane can restore the integrity of the building’s roof system, prevent further damage, and improve energy efficiency. The overview below groups typical Single Ply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or patching or small sections of single ply roofing typ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the size and complexity of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Partial Replacement - replacing sections of a single ply roof can range from $1,500 to $4,000. Local contractors often handle these jobs efficiently within this band, though larger or more complex partial replacements may cost more.
Full Roof Replacement - complete single ply roof replacements usually cost between $5,000 and $15,000. Many standard projects fall into this range, with larger or more intricate jobs potentially exceeding this estimate.
Large or Complex Projects - extensive or highly customized single ply roof replacements can reach $20,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to involve significant structural or design challenges that impact overall cost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
